How What Happens When You Get Arrested: A Friend's Guide to the Process Actually Works
The process begins at the moment an officer makes an arrest, which usually occurs when there is probable cause or an arrest warrant. After being taken into custody, the person is transported to a police station for booking, where personal information, photographs, and fingerprints are recorded. During booking, officers also conduct an inventory search of belongings and may hold the individual in a holding area or jail cell while awaiting further procedures. Next comes the initial court appearance, often called an arraignment, where the charges are read and a plea may be entered with the guidance of the court. Throughout each stage, constitutional protections like the right to remain silent and the right to an attorney help safeguard the individualโs interests. Common Questions People Have About What Happens When You Get Arrested: A Friend's Guide to the Process
Many people wonder how quickly a release decision is made after an arrest. In most cases, jurisdictions allow for a bail hearing or a scheduled court date to determine whether the person can be released before trial. Another frequent question is whether anything said during questioning can be used in court, and the answer often depends on whether Miranda rights were properly read and followed. People also ask how bond or bail amounts are determined, which usually depends on the severity of the charges, prior record, and local guidelines. Things People Often Misunderstand
One widespread myth is that being arrested automatically means a person is guilty, but courts operate on the principle of innocence until proven guilty. Another misconception is that all charges result in jail time, when many cases lead to alternative outcomes like probation, community service, or diversion programs. Some assume that police must answer all questions during a stop, yet individuals generally have the right to decline answering certain questions without legal counsel.
